Travel chaos as protestors shut off Heathrow Tunnel

DEMONSTRATORS have blockaded the entrance tunnel to Heathrow Airport in a protest against plans to build a third runway. 

Five activists from the environmental group Plane Stupid are locked in a van with ‘No new runways’ printed over a black banner across the vehicle and police are at the rush hour scene. 

Traffic has been pushed back to the M4 according to motorists keeping track of the incident on Twitter. Delays are expected until 10.30am.

A spokesman for Heathrow said passengers planning to travel to the airport by road should make plan for delays. 

“We can confirm there is a protest taking place in the inbound tunnel which is currently affecting traffic around the central terminal area and Terminals 2 and 3 at Heathrow,” the spokesman said. “Police are now on site but we urge passengers to allow extra time getting to the airport today.”

Cameron Kaye, a spokesman for Plane Stupid, said the protest was being staged because of concerns about the impact a third runway could have on the environment.

“Airport expansion would wreck the legally binding Climate Change Act, risking wiping out 55 per cent of species this century and displacing 75 mIllion more people from their homes by 2035,” Kaye said in a statement on the group’s website.
